The effect of social media influencers on consumers' brand preference: A study on cosmetic brands

Abstract (EN)

The emergence and propagation of the Internet bring forward the concept of social media. The increase in the population of social media and its popularity has caused both consumers and brands to turn towards this new field day by day. Brand communication can be managed via their corporate account that is created by the brand itself. On the other hand, it has brought forward the idea of the social media user's playing an active role in the brand communication along with social media's activating everybody about content production. Social media provides all users to create their own profiles, come together with the people of same interest and form an interaction. It also provides other people who are indirectly connected to carry out brand communication. Nowadays, the social media influencers have come into prominence in brand communication that is carried out as users-centered apart from the brand itself. In recent years, social media influencers, who have a large number of followers in social media having been able to influence the evaluations of other social media users with their opinions, suggestions and comments, and to shape their opinions, have shared contents for brands. In this study, it is aimed to determine whether the social media influencers affect the brand preferences of the individuals who follow them or not. For this purpose, a survey was carried out with the participation of 519 people using quantitative research methods. Before the research, a preliminary test was conducted with the participation of 30 people between April 8th and April 14th, 2019, and the questionnaire was revised and finalised in accordance with the results of the pre-test. The questionnaire form which was made online between 18 April - 03 May 2019 was answered by 520 participants and 519 of these forms were analyzed. Data obtained from research have analyzed and interpreted by SPSS program. Findings indicate that the social media influencers do not have a positive effect on the cosmetic brand preference of consumers, findings shows that audiences don't find the sharings of social media influencers about cosmetic brands reliable. In addition, according to the demographic characteristics of the participants, the use of social media in the search for information about the cosmetic brands, the effect of social media influencers on the cosmetic brand preference and whether the content shared by the social media influencers are reliable by the followers revealed that there is a statistically significant difference between the groups. The findings are interpreted within the scope of the study. Key Words: Brand, Brand Communication, Brand Preference, Social Media, Social Media Influencers
